All of Us Are Dead

South Korean zombie drama of 12 episodes adapted from Joo Dong-geun's webtoon Now at Our School, released on Netflix in 2022. A virus transforms high school students into zombies, and the survivors must organize to escape the quarantined school. A teen horror thriller that propelled the Korean zombie genre to the top of Netflix's worldwide charts.

Twenty-Five Twenty-One

South Korean drama of 16 episodes written by Kwon Do-eun, aired on tvN in 2022. Against the backdrop of the 1998 Asian financial crisis, an 18-year-old fencer and a 22-year-old journalist meet and experience an unforgettable first love. A nostalgic and poetic coming-of-age story celebrating the beauty of first loves and the pain of growing up.

Signal

South Korean crime drama of 16 episodes written by Kim Eun-hee, aired on tvN in 2016. A present-day profiler communicates via an old walkie-talkie with a detective from the past to solve cold cases inspired by real Korean criminal cases. A critically acclaimed time-travel thriller, considered one of the best Asian crime series ever produced.

Move to Heaven

South Korean drama of 10 episodes released on Netflix in 2021. A young autistic man and his uncle, a former convict, take over the family trauma cleaning business and discover the untold stories of the deceased through their personal belongings. A touching and delicate drama exploring grief, memory, and the invisible bonds between the living and the dead.

Begin Again

Chinese romantic drama of 35 episodes aired on Hunan TV in 2020. Lu Fangning, a demanding businesswoman in the luxury sector, and Ling Rui, a talented but rebellious designer, clash in the world of haute couture before falling in love. A corporate romance with polished aesthetics set in the Chinese fashion world.

Word of Honor (Shan He Ling)

Chinese wuxia drama of 36 episodes adapted from Priest's danmei novel Tian Ya Ke, aired on Youku in 2021. Zhou Zishu, a former master assassin of a government organization, meets Wen Kexing, the mysterious leader of Ghost Valley, and the two men travel together through the martial arts world. An international success that strengthened the popularity of the wuxia-danmei genre.

Story of Yanxi Palace

Chinese historical drama of 70 episodes written by Zhou Mo, aired on iQiyi in 2018. Wei Yingluo, a palace maid during Emperor Qianlong's reign, climbs the ranks of the imperial harem to avenge her sister's death. A Chinese cultural phenomenon that became the most searched TV show on Google worldwide in 2018.

Love O2O

Chinese drama of 30 episodes adapted from Gu Man's novel, aired on Jiangsu TV in 2016. A brilliant computer science student meets the number one player of an MMORPG and their virtual romance transforms into a real love story. A pioneering romantic comedy of the 'e-sport romance' genre that launched Yang Yang's international career.

Nirvana in Fire (Lang Ya Bang)

Chinese drama of 54 episodes adapted from Hai Yan's novel, aired on Hunan TV in 2015. Mei Changsu, a brilliant and ailing strategist, orchestrates from the shadows the rehabilitation of his unjustly accused father and the reform of the empire. Considered the absolute masterpiece of the Chinese historical genre, praised for its masterful writing and complex political intrigues.

Midnight Diner (Shinya Shokudo)

Japanese series adapted from Abe Yaro's manga, aired on TBS then Netflix from 2009 to 2019 (5 seasons). A small Tokyo restaurant, open only from midnight to seven in the morning, welcomes night-time customers for whom the silent chef prepares their favorite dish. A contemplative ode to Japanese cuisine and the human stories that unfold over a meal.

Alice in Borderland

Japanese survival series adapted from Haro Aso's manga, produced by Netflix in 2020-2022 (2 seasons, 16 episodes). Arisu, an aimless young gamer, finds himself in a deserted Tokyo where he must participate in deadly games symbolized by playing cards to survive. A gripping thriller that rivaled Squid Game on the international stage.

Extraordinary Attorney Woo

South Korean drama of 16 episodes written by Moon Ji-won, aired on ENA/Netflix in 2022. Woo Young-woo, a brilliant autistic attorney passionate about whales, joins a major law firm and confronts prejudice while solving cases with a unique perspective. An unexpected global phenomenon that highlighted neurodiversity in Korean popular culture.

Business Proposal

South Korean drama of 12 episodes adapted from HaeHwa's webtoon, aired on SBS in 2022. An employee goes on a blind date in place of her friend and runs into the CEO of her own company, who decides to marry her to stop the blind dates imposed by his grandfather. A light and refreshing romantic comedy that won over global audiences on Netflix.

Vincenzo

South Korean drama of 20 episodes written by Park Jae-beom, aired on tvN in 2021. An Italian-Korean lawyer, consigliere of the Italian mafia, returns to Seoul to retrieve a hidden treasure beneath a building threatened with demolition by a corrupt conglomerate. A flamboyant legal thriller blending action, dark humor, and anti-heroic justice.

Itaewon Class

South Korean drama of 16 episodes adapted from Gwang Jin's webtoon, aired on JTBC in 2020. A young man fresh out of prison opens a bar-restaurant in Seoul's Itaewon neighborhood to take revenge on the food conglomerate responsible for his father's death. A tale of perseverance and social justice carried by Park Seo-joon's charisma.

My Love from the Star

South Korean drama of 21 episodes written by Park Ji-eun, aired on SBS in 2013-2014. An alien arrives on Earth during the Joseon dynasty and lives among humans for 400 years before falling in love with a famous and capricious actress. A cultural phenomenon that triggered the Hallyu wave in China and popularized K-dramas across Asia.

Hospital Playlist

South Korean medical drama of 2 seasons (24 episodes) created by the duo Shin Won-ho and Lee Woo-jung, aired on tvN in 2020-2021. Five doctors who have been friends since medical school reunite at the same hospital and form an amateur band. A warm drama celebrating adult friendship, medical vocation, and the small joys of daily life.

Reply 1988

South Korean drama of 20 episodes from the Reply series, written by Lee Woo-jung and aired on tvN in 2015-2016. In the Ssangmun-dong neighborhood of Seoul in 1988, five neighboring families share their daily lives during a time of great change in South Korea. Considered one of the greatest K-dramas of all time, celebrated for its warm nostalgia and deeply human characters.

Goblin (Guardian: The Lonely and Great God)

South Korean fantasy drama of 16 episodes written by Kim Eun-sook, aired on tvN in 2016-2017. An immortal warrior from the Goryeo dynasty searches for a human bride who can remove the invisible sword lodged in his chest to end his eternal life. A masterpiece of Korean fantasy, celebrated for its cinematic aesthetics and poetic dialogue.

Crash Landing on You

South Korean drama of 16 episodes written by Park Ji-eun, aired on tvN in 2019-2020. A South Korean heiress accidentally lands in North Korea during a paragliding accident and falls in love with a North Korean officer. An iconic romance that broke audience records in Korea and became a worldwide phenomenon on Netflix.

Squid Game

South Korean survival series created by Hwang Dong-hyuk, released on Netflix in 2021. Hundreds of debt-ridden people compete in deadly children's games for a prize of 45.6 billion won. It became the most-watched series in Netflix history, redefining global popular culture and propelling Korean entertainment onto the international stage.

The Untamed (Chen Qing Ling)

Chinese drama of 50 episodes adapted from Mo Xiang Tong Xiu's danmei novel Mo Dao Zu Shi, aired in 2019 on Tencent Video. Wei Wuxian, an unorthodox cultivator resurrected after thirteen years, reunites with his former companion Lan Wangji to solve a series of supernatural mysteries. A global cultural phenomenon that popularized the xianxia genre with international audiences.
